Official public geo-restriction language found in Valutrades Help Center footer disclaimer: services/information are not intended for residents of the United States of America (US), Belgium (BE), Iran (IR), and the Democratic People's Republic of Korea (KP), and also not intended for any person in any country/jurisdiction where distribution or use would be contrary to local law or regulation. This statement is not explicitly separated by regulatory entity; it appears as a global restriction/disclaimer across Valutrades' materials. No official per-entity restricted-country list was located in the Valutrades UK (FCA) Terms of Business PDF or the Valutrades Seychelles Client Services Agreement PDF beyond generic 'comply with applicable laws' language.

Valutrades is a brokerage firm established in 2013, with its headquarters located in London, United Kingdom. The company was founded with the vision of providing retail and institutional traders access to the forex and CFD markets through advanced trading platforms and competitive trading conditions. Over the years, Valutrades has carved a niche for itself as a provider of raw spread ECN accounts, catering to traders who require tight spreads and deep liquidity.
Valutrades is owned by Valutrades Limited, a company that has consistently focused on offering high-quality trading services while maintaining transparency and trust with its clients. Despite being a smaller brokerage firm compared to some of its competitors, Valutrades has managed to build a solid reputation in the financial industry by prioritising customer satisfaction and regulatory compliance.
Regulatory compliance is a cornerstone of Valutrades' operations. The broker is authorised and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) in the United Kingdom, under licence number 586541. The FCA is renowned for its stringent regulatory standards, which ensures that Valutrades adheres to robust financial practices and client protection measures. In addition to its FCA regulation, Valutrades is also regulated by the Seychelles Financial Services Authority (FSA) under licence number SD028, which provides additional oversight and assurance to clients.
Client fund protection is a critical aspect of Valutrades' regulatory compliance framework. The broker ensures that client funds are held in segregated bank accounts, separate from the company's operational funds, to safeguard against any potential financial mismanagement. Furthermore, Valutrades' FCA regulation entitles eligible clients to protection under the Financial Services Compensation Scheme (FSCS), which provides compensation of up to £85,000 in the unlikely event of the firm's insolvency. Such measures are instrumental in fostering client confidence and trust in the broker's operations.
Valutrades offers a competitive fee structure, particularly appealing to traders who prioritise tight spreads and cost-effectiveness. The broker provides access to raw spread ECN accounts, which means spreads start from as low as 0 pips on major currency pairs such as EUR/USD. This feature is particularly attractive to high-frequency traders and scalpers who rely on minimal trading costs for profitability. For other asset classes like indices and commodities, Valutrades maintains similarly competitive spreads, ensuring that traders can maximise their trading efficiency across various markets.
In addition to its competitive spreads, Valutrades employs a commission-based pricing model for its ECN accounts. Clients are charged a commission of $3 per lot per side, which is considered reasonable within the industry. This transparent commission structure allows traders to accurately calculate their trading costs and manage their strategies more effectively. It is worth noting that the commission rates may vary depending on the trading platform and account type chosen by the client.
Overnight swap rates, also known as rollover rates, are another consideration for traders using Valutrades. These rates apply to positions held open overnight and can either incur a cost or generate a rebate, depending on the direction of the trade and the interest rate differentials between the currencies involved. Valutrades provides detailed information on its swap rates, which are updated regularly to reflect market conditions. Traders can access these rates directly from the trading platform, allowing them to make informed decisions about holding positions overnight.
Valutrades does not impose any deposit or withdrawal fees, making it easier for clients to manage their funds without worrying about additional costs. This policy is particularly beneficial for traders who frequently move funds in and out of their trading accounts. However, traders should be aware that third-party payment providers may charge their own fees, which are beyond the broker's control. Furthermore, Valutrades does not charge an inactivity fee, which is a notable advantage compared to some competitors who impose charges on dormant accounts. This absence of inactivity fees allows traders the flexibility to step away from trading without incurring penalties.
Valutrades offers robust trading platforms, focusing primarily on the widely acclaimed M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MetaTrader 5 (MT5) platforms. While Valutrades does not provide a proprietary web-based platform, both MT4 and MT5 can be accessed via web terminals. The web versions are designed for traders who require flexibility and prefer not to download software. These platforms offer a streamlined interface with essential functionalities, including real-time quotes, advanced charting tools, and a variety of order types. The web-based interface is accessible across all major browsers and operating systems, ensuring a seamless trading experience regardless of the device used.
The desktop versions of MT4 and MT5 offered by Valutrades provide a more comprehensive array of tools and features, ideal for professional traders seeking advanced analytical capabilities. The desktop platforms are renowned for their sophisticated charting tools, which include 30 built-in technical indicators and 24 graphical objects. Traders can utilise nine timeframes for thorough analysis, ranging from one minute to one month, to suit various trading strategies. Additionally, MT5 expands on these features with 38 technical indicators and 44 graphical objects, alongside the ability to open up to 100 charts simultaneously, offering unparalleled depth in market analysis.
Valutrades recognises the increasing need for mobility in trading, hence the availability of MT4 and MT5 mobile apps for iOS and Android devices. These applications offer a feature-rich experience similar to their desktop counterparts. Traders can execute a wide range of order types, view real-time quotes, and engage in technical analysis using interactive charts and a wide selection of indicators. The mobile platforms are highly responsive, allowing traders to manage their accounts efficiently while on the move. Alerts and push notifications can also be set up to ensure traders never miss important market movements.
Valutrades enhances the MetaTrader experience by allowing API and algorithmic trading, catering to traders who utilise automated trading strategies. The platforms support Expert Advisors (EAs) for automated trading, and traders can integrate third-party tools to further customise their trading environment. While Valutrades does not offer a proprietary plugin for additional functionality, the comprehensive range of third-party integrations available through the MetaTrader marketplace ensures traders can access a vast library of apps and tools to support their strategies. Furthermore, these platforms enable setting alerts for various market events, helping traders stay informed and react promptly to market changes.
Valutrades offers three primary account types, each tailored to different trading needs: the Standard Account, the Raw ECN Account, and the Islamic Account. The Standard Account is suitable for new traders or those who prefer zero commissions with slightly wider spreads, starting from 1 pip. The Raw ECN Account is designed for more experienced traders who seek tighter spreads starting from 0 pips, with a commission charged per trade. Lastly, the Islamic Account is compliant with Sharia law, offering swap-free trading conditions. It is essentially similar to the Raw ECN Account but without overnight interest charges.
Each account type at Valutrades provides access to the full suite of trading platforms, including MT4 and MT5, and allows trading across all available markets—forex, CFDs, indices, and commodities. The Standard Account does not charge commissions but has wider spreads, making it ideal for those who prefer a straightforward fee structure. The Raw ECN Account, on the other hand, appeals to traders who prioritise low spreads and are willing to pay a commission for tighter pricing. All account types offer maximum leverage of up to 1:500, providing significant trading power, although traders should employ risk management strategies effectively.
The minimum deposit for opening an account with Valutrades is $100, making it accessible for traders with limited capital. Deposits can be made through various methods, including bank transfers, credit/debit cards, and popular e-wallets such as Skrill and Neteller. This flexibility ensures that traders can fund their accounts via their preferred payment method. Valutrades also offers a demo account that allows potential clients to test the platform's features and practice trading strategies without financial risk. The demo account is available for both MT4 and MT5 platforms, providing a realistic trading environment to hone skills before committing to live trading.
Valutrades offers a focused range of markets, primarily catering to traders interested in forex and CFDs. The platform provides access to over 80 currency pairs, making it an attractive choice for forex enthusiasts. These pairs include major, minor, and exotic currencies, allowing traders to diversify their forex strategies extensively. The competitive spreads offered, starting from 0 pips, further enhance the appeal of forex trading with Valutrades.
Beyond forex, Valutrades offers a selection of CFDs covering a variety of asset classes. Traders can access CFDs on indices and commodities, broadening their trading opportunities. The platform features major indices such as the FTSE 100, S&P 500, and DAX 30, which are popular among traders looking to speculate on market trends without direct ownership of the underlying assets. Commodities available for trading include energy products like crude oil and natural gas, as well as precious metals such as gold and silver.
While Valutrades provides a solid offering in forex and CFDs on indices and commodities, it lacks coverage in certain areas such as cryptocurrencies and a broader range of equities. This limited market range might not cater to traders seeking a more diversified portfolio across various asset classes. However, the focus on forex and core CFDs ensures specialised service and potentially more competitive conditions in these markets.
Valutrades places a strong emphasis on the safety and security of its clients' funds. Being reg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) in the UK and the Financial Services Authority (FSA) of Seychelles, Valutrades adheres to stringent regulatory standards. These regulations include the segregation of client funds from the company's operating capital, ensuring that traders' funds are protected even in the unlikely event of company insolvency.
Valutrades also implements robust security measures to protect client data and transactions. The broker employs advanced encryption technologies to safeguard sensitive information and ensure the integrity of online transactions. Additionally, Valutrades offers negative balance protection, which prevents traders from losing more than their initial deposit. This feature is crucial in volatile markets, as it provides an additional layer of financial security for traders.
Valutrades is particularly well-suited for forex traders who prioritise a platform with competitive spreads and high leverage options. With a maximum leverage of up to 1:500, the broker is ideal for seasoned traders who are comfortable with the risks associated with high-leverage trading. Moreover, the support for both MT4 and MT5 platforms provides flexibility for traders who prefer these industry-standard platforms.
For beginners, Valutrades offers a low minimum deposit requirement of $100, making it accessible to traders with limited initial capital. However, the limited range of markets might not be sufficient for those looking to explore a broader spectrum of trading opportunities beyond forex and basic CFDs. As such, it may be more appealing to traders with a clear focus on forex and specific CFD markets.
The absence of cryptocurrency trading is a notable limitation for traders interested in digital currencies. Therefore, Valutrades might not be the best fit for individuals seeking exposure to the rapidly growing crypto market. Additionally, because Valutrades is a smaller broker with limited brand recognition, those who prioritise trading with globally renowned institutions might opt for larger, more established brokers.
